PPP has nothing to fear from Elections 2020 Commission of Inquiry -says Jagdeo

With the Government planning to move ahead with a Commission of Inquiry into the 2020 Elections, Vice President Bharrat Jagdeo declared this afternoon that his party, the People’s Progressive Party is not fearful of any such inquiry.

“The PPP has nothing to fear from a Commission of Inquiry. We believe that the Commission of Inquiry will that APNU as we all know, sought to steal the elections. And this Commission of Inquiry shall be very uncomfortable for the same people who have been calling for an internal review”, Mr. Jagdeo said at an afternoon press conference.

The Chairman of the Guyana Elections Commission ruled recently against conducting an internal review of the 2020 elections and the shortcomings of the Elections Commission and other related issues.

The Opposition nominated members of the Elections Commission were pushing for the internal probe.

Last week, President Irfaan Ali announced his decision to proceed with the International Commission of Inquiry into the 2020 elections. He had promised to convene the CoI during his inauguration speech to the nation in 2020.

Today, Vice President Jagdeo said “many times the Opposition misunderstand our desire to move forward as a country as somehow of a weakness. And that we are consciously moving forward and ignoring a lot of things because we just want to remain positive and move the country ahead and address the task at hand”.

The Vice President slapped down claims that the PPP was involved in any attempts to change the outcome of the elections. He said all of the commentators who have been making those statements will get the chance to provide the evidence to the Commission of Inquiry.
